The Skeats Saint John'S, Newfoundland and Labrador

Originally from Glovertown, NL in 2014, The Skeats members consist of James Keats (Lead Guitar/Lead Vocals) Josh Organ (Bass/Back up Vocals) and Daniel Keats (Percussion/Back up Vocals) we are a rock band that came straight from the bay to kick your ass all the way back there!
